阿里云国际站代理商:阿里云服务器并发系统是什么?

本文由阿里云代理商【聚搜云】撰写

简介:TG@luotuoemo

1. 负载均衡

负载均衡是解决并发问题的核心手段之一,通过将流量均匀分配到多个服务器,提高系统的并发处理能力。阿里云提供了多种负载均衡产品,如SLB(Server Load Balancer) ,可以根据实际负载情况动态调整流量分配。

2. 弹性伸缩

弹性伸缩服务可以根据流量自动调整服务器数量。在高并发场景下,系统会自动增加服务器实例以应对流量高峰;流量下降时则减少实例,节省成本。

3. 缓存技术

缓存可以显著减轻数据库的压力,提高系统的响应速度。阿里云提供了多种缓存服务,如RedisMemcached,通过将常用数据缓存在内存中,减少对数据库的直接访问。

4. 数据库优化

数据库的性能直接影响系统的并发能力。阿里云提供了多种高性能数据库产品,如RDS(关系型数据库服务)PolarDB,支持高并发读写操作。通过优化数据库结构、索引和查询语句,可以进一步提升性能。

5. CDN加速

CDN(内容分发网络)通过将静态内容缓存到全球分布的节点上,让用户就近获取数据,从而减少服务器的负载压力,提高访问速度。

6. 分布式架构

通过分布式架构,将应用和服务部署到多个服务器或集群上,实现负载均衡和高可用性。阿里云的**EDAS(企业级分布式应用服务)**支持微服务架构的高效部署和管理,能够显著提升系统的并发处理能力。

7. 高并发架构设计

在架构层面,可以通过以下方式优化高并发处理:

  • 服务器集群:将多个服务器集中起来提供同一种服务,利用并行计算提高处理速度。
  • 多层负载均衡:通过DNS负载均衡和应用层负载均衡(如Nginx)进一步优化流量分配。
  • 动静分离:将静态资源(如图片、CSS、JS)通过CDN分发,动态内容通过应用服务器处理。

8. 监控与优化

阿里云提供了完善的监控和分析工具,实时监控服务器的负载情况,及时发现并解决问题。通过优化代码、调整资源配置和优化网络架构,可以进一步提升系统的并发能力。